Output 77d2466e69f7e499867f7836554e8da3a5b6a6e128eb11bd3ced5e2a76aaff2a:0

value
18801569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521cb0b5aecb7b57a673facbf0ae3aff393d278a OP_EQUAL
address
39BBhi52ufdU9PVLzoUKQdYky5wn3X5TBw
transaction
77d2466e69f7e499867f7836554e8da3a5b6a6e128eb11bd3ced5e2a76aaff2a
spent
true